which is down to the comment below,

	/* all workers gone, wq exit can proceed */
	if (!nr_workers && refcount_dec_and_test(&wqe->wq->refs))
		complete(&wqe->wq->done);

because there might be multiple cases of wqe in a wq and we would wait
for every worker in every wqe to go home before releasing wq's resources
on destroying.

To that end, rework wq's refcount by making it independent of the tracking
of workers because after all they are two different things, and keeping
it balanced when workers come and go. Note the manager kthread, like
other workers, now holds a grab to wq during its lifetime.

Finally to help destroy wq, check IO_WQ_BIT_EXIT upon creating worker
and do nothing for exiting wq.
